摘要

An adaptive linear channel equalizer having an asymmetrical filter structure and an equalizing method thereof are provided to locate a main tap at a left end of a filter in setting a filter coefficient for removing precursor-ISI(Inter-Symbol Interference) and locate the main tap at a right end thereof in setting a filter coefficient for removing postcursor-ISI, thereby implementing a relatively expanded equalization range and effectively removing ISI without increase of operation quantity in a channel having long time delay. Equalization filters(121,122) have main taps whose positions are varied when filter coefficients for removing precursor-ISI and postcursor-ISI of an input signal including practical information are set on a basis of an inputted training sequence. A tap position control unit(130) controls the positions of the main taps. A filter coefficient storage unit(150) stores the filter coefficients outputted from the equalization filters. A signal output unit multiplies the input signal including the practical information by the filter coefficients stored in the filter coefficient storage unit, and thereby compensates distortion of the input signal.
